Search
Directions
Maps
•
Dubai
•
Restaurants
Just Falafel LLC
No reviews yet
Write review
May not be open
+971 4 3699757
Show phone
Control Tower, Al Hebiah 1, Dubai Land, Dubai
Directions
Add photo or video
Overview
Photos
Reviews
Features
Address
Control Tower, Al Hebiah 1, Dubai Land, Dubai
Directions
Contacts
+971 4 3699757
Show phone
Business hours
May not be open
Schedule
Edit information
Directions
Autodrome Stadium
460 m
4
Autodrome Stadium
ICC Headquarter
Dubai Studio City Entrance 1
Dubai Studio City, Glitz 3
Prime Business Tower
Show parking info
Features
Restaurant
Info about organization
Are you the owner of this organization?
Similar places nearby
Noodle Box
Restaurant
Still no ratings
Grill Ville
Restaurant
Still no ratings
Curry Box
Restaurant
Still no ratings
Acai and Co
Cafe
Still no ratings
German Doner Kebab
Fast food
Still no ratings
Sumo Sushi and Bento
Sushi bar
Still no ratings
Kababji Grill
Restaurant
Still no ratings
Curry Box
Restaurant
Still no ratings
Rate this place